Requirements:

Basic Requirements: The Financial Manager - Chief Financial Officer position involves professional accounting responsibilities that require professional accounting knowledge. You must meet one of the requirements described below to receive further consideration for the Financial Manager - Chief Financial Officer position. NOTE: Transcripts (unofficial or official) MUST be submitted with your application materials. Education cannot be credited without documentation. Also, all supporting documentation MUST be submitted for determination to be made as to meeting the Basic Requirements.

A. Degree: You must possess a Bachelor's degree or higher in accounting or in a related field such as business administration, finance, or public administration that included or was supplemented by 24 semester hours in accounting. The 24 hours may include up to 6 hours of credit in business law. ~OR~
B. Combination of Education and Experience: You must possess at least four (4) years of experience in accounting, or an equivalent combination of accounting experience, college-level education, and training that provided professional accounting knowledge. Your background must also include one of the following:

a) Twenty-four semester hours in accounting or auditing courses of appropriate type and quality. This can include up to 6 hours of business law. ~OR~
b) A certificate as Certified Public Accountant or a Certified Internal Auditor, obtained through written examination. ~OR~
c) Completion of the requirements for a Bachelor's degree or higher that included substantial course work in accounting or auditing, e.g., 15 semester hours, but that does not fully satisfy the 24-semester-hour requirement of paragraph A, provided that (a) you have successfully worked at the full-performance level in accounting, auditing, or a related field, e.g., valuation engineering or financial institution examining; (b) a panel of at least two higher level professional accountants or auditors has determined that the applicant has demonstrated a good knowledge of accounting and of related and underlying fields that equals in breadth, depth, currency, and level of advancement that which is normally associated with successful completion of the 4-year course of study described in paragraph A; and (c) except for literal nonconformance to the requirement of 24 semester hours in accounting, the applicant's education, training, and experience fully meet the specified requirements. NOTE: At the time of application, you must submit a copy of your transcript and all supporting documentation. ~ AND ~

In addition to meeting one of the Basic Requirements described above , to qualify for this position at the GS-14 level, you must meet the following:

Experience: You must have at least one (1) full year of specialized experience equivalent to at least the next lower grade level (GS-13) in the Federal service that has given you the particular knowledge, skills, and abilities required to successfully perform the duties of the Financial Manager - Chief Financial Officer, and that is typically in or related to the work of the position to be filled. Specialized experience is experience where you were responsible for providing managerial oversight for the full range of fiscal activities and staff; developing accounting policies and procedures; utilizing in-depth knowledge of financial management systems, including administering an accounting system to collect and review all financial data; developing performance specifications and standards for financial programs and activities; developing/executing budget and financial plans; and providing financial advice to management for effective decision making, program planning, and policy formulation.NOTE: Experience must be fully documented on your resume and must include job title, duties, month and year start/end dates, AND hours worked per week.

IMPORTANT: A full year of work is considered to be 35-40 hours of work per week. All experience listed on your resume must include the month and year start/end dates. Part-time experience will be credited on the basis of time actually spent in appropriate activities. Applicants wishing to receive credit for such experience must indicate clearly the nature of their duties and responsibilities in each position and the number of hours a week spent in such employment.

Experience refers to paid and unpaid experience, including volunteer work done through National Service programs (e.g., Peace Corps, AmeriCorps) and other organizations (e.g., professional; philanthropic; religious; spiritual; community; student; social). Volunteer work helps build critical competencies, knowledge, and skills and can provide valuable training and experience that translates directly to paid employment. You will receive credit for all qualifying experience, including volunteer experience.

Physical Requirements: The work of the position is principally sedentary and is usually performed in an office setting.
